[5] #2. A solid spherical mass M1 = 0.35 kg and radius 3.80 cm is concentric with a spherical shell
M2 = 0.54 kg and radius 7.20 cm as shown. A point mass m = 50.6 grams is at a distance of 4.88 cm from M1
the center of the solid sphere. Based on the shell theorems, determine the gravitational force on m. m
Answer: a. 4.96 x 10-10 N. b. 6.30 x 10-10 N. c. 7.64 x 10-10 N. d. 9.85 x 10-10 N. e. 1.48 x 10-9 N.
Explanation / Answer
Force due to M2 will be zero as m is inside the shell M2
net force on m = GM1m/r^2
= 6.674x10^-11x0.35x0.0506/(0.0488)^2
=4.96 x 10-10 N
